    Asbestos Attorneys

    Despite the fact that asbestos use declined in the 1970s exposure to this harmful mineral could cause life-threatening diseases like mesothelioma. New Yorkers should consult a mesothelioma lawyer in the event that they suspect they or a family member has been exposed to asbestos.

    Asbestos lawyers could sue owners of the buildings or worksites and asbestos product manufacturers, and other parties responsible. Some lawyers specialize in filing claims for veterans' compensation and trust funds compensation.

    Workers' Compensation

    Injured workers who are sickened by asbestos exposure might be eligible to claim workers compensation benefits. Workers' compensation benefits can include medical expenses, partial wages, and other costs related to work-related injuries. Workers' compensation claims are not the best option for asbestos-exposed people since they provide a lower maximum benefit amount and have a restricted filing period.

    An experienced attorney can help determine whether an asbestos-related illness is a work-related accident and determine if an individual is eligible for benefits under workers comp. A lawyer can also explain the state-specific laws that govern workers' compensation. They can also assist in meeting the deadlines that differ from state to state. An attorney can advise on other legal options to obtain compensation, such filing an asbestos lawsuit or mesothelioma fund claim.

    A lawyer can also determine the most likely sources of liability for a person's asbestos-related disease. Asbestos, which is a fibrous chemical can trigger serious health problems, including asbestosis or mesothelioma. An attorney can look into the client's job history and locate potential asbestos-exposure locations. Typically, the most likely employers for people who suffers from an asbestos-related disease are construction and demolition companies as well as shipyards, power plants and schools as well as other public works facilities.

    Asbestos can be airborne and inhaled by employees and others who visit a site. The microscopic fibers of asbestos can get lodged in lungs and other organs within the body creating inflammation and scarring that leads to tumors, cancers and other diseases. Many asbestos legal victims are unaware that their illnesses are related to their exposure for years.

    A New York workers compensation attorney can assist clients in getting the financial assistance they require as well as pursue justice against negligent employer. This is crucial for those who suffer from as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ma. Asbestos-related patients typically have to quit their jobs due to their health issues. They may also have additional expenses like funeral costs or caregiving for family. An experienced attorney can help them obtain full and fair compensation.

    Personal Injury

    Asbestos lawyers help victims who have been exposed to asbestos case (site) and are now suffering from an illness or illness such as mesothelioma. The condition can develop between 15 and 60 years after exposure and can be fatal. In addition to bringing a lawsuit against the company responsible for exposure, victims may also be eligible for financ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.

    asbestos legal is a class of naturally occurring minerals that are made of fine, strong fibers. Because of its resistance to heat, fire and chemicals the mineral was sought-after by industrial companies for a variety of items in the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turers were not able to reveal or actively conceal asbestos' dangers, and resulted in the deaths of a number of Americans.

    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, are able to bring a personal injury suit against the companies who manufactured and distributed or installed the deadly material. The lawsuits seek to recover compensation for the victims' medical bills, lost wages, and suffering and pain.

    New York law generally gives plaintiffs three years from date of diagnosis to file an action for personal injury. However the statute of limitations is usually extended in asbestos cases since symptoms are not typically evident for 30 to 50 years following the initial exposure.

    Lawyers with experience in mesothelioma can help victims and their families determine the exact source of exposure. Utilizing the resources of national asbestos claim firms they can assist victims understand when and where their exposure occurred.

    The lawyers may then make an workers' compensation claim on behalf of the victims, or, if the employer is no longer operating and the asbestos manufacturer is no longer in business, bring a lawsuit against the asbestos manufacturer. Additionally, the lawyers can help clients seek VA benefits or receive financial compensation from asbestos trust funds if they aren't eligible for a workers' compensation claim.

    Many asbestos-related illnesses leave sufferers in a state of incapacity and require costly medical treatment.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er will argue for financial compensation that covers the medical costs of a patient and allow them to live a normal life as they recover.

    Wrongful Death

    If someone is killed by asbestos exposure, the family can bring a lawsuit for the wrongful death. This type of lawsuit is filed on behalf of the deceased's estate, and it is possible to file it regardless of whether or not the deceased person had an estate plan. A lawyer who handles wrongful deaths can assist family members in seeking compensation from the people responsible for the death of their loved ones.

    These claims are brought against employers and property owners who neglected to keep workers safe from asbestos. The principal issue in these cases is asbestos particles, once inhaled, cause fibrosis to develop in the lung's lining. Over time, fibrosis can turn malignant and cause mesothelioma or other cancers. Asbestos wrongful-death lawyers must prove that the defendant's negligence caused the asbestos-related condition. They must also prove that the mesothelioma is the direct result of exposure to asbestos. This requires accessing medical records, examining witnesses, and obtaining documents from the workplaces where the deceased was employed.

    Attorneys who specialize in wrongful death cases involving asbestos attorney exposure will ensure that their clients receive the compensation they deserve. Compensation can cover a variety of losses, such as medical expenses and lost wages. Compensation for mesothelioma may also be used to pay for funeral expenses and the loss of companionship. Compensation can even be accessible through government-sponsored asbestos trust funds.

    M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ases take decades to show symptoms. This is why it's crucial to act quickly. By retaining the services of a New York asbestos lawyer, families can secure their rights to financial compensation.
